Title :
Video format conversions between HDTV systems

Abstract :
Video format conversion methods between existing or proposed HDTV (high-definition television) systems are described. The techniques necessary for this system are interlaced-to-progressive conversion (IPC), line-rate-conversion (LRC), sampling-rate-conversion (SRC), and frame-rate-conversion (FRC). An improved motion-adaptive method which consists of several modes, e.g. stationary mode, motion compensated mode, and intra-field mode, is used to perform the IPC. For LRC and SRC, a simple edge-preserving weighted linear interpolation technique is used. It has ben found that the converted images using the proposed method visually do not have any undesirable artifacts
